Output 05fd67ab21b4e31bbe344c11982e30ab0e4a4a4f9fa64da190e7f4b5a7abd1ab:21

value
4222881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3e01e7d43773dc0c06f99be19433944a5ad2348 OP_EQUAL
address
3NTuoA5E6CWhcucLLmbPdNt9YZrirJgexK
transaction
05fd67ab21b4e31bbe344c11982e30ab0e4a4a4f9fa64da190e7f4b5a7abd1ab
spent
true